Output 8d3fccefa10d6ce03667c948bf381908c13aaf511b7409018bb0089ddbaaf046:1

value
2671
script pubkey
OP_0 OP_PUSHBYTES_20 f3fb43365f5ad0aca51495384ee4289e2bd23056
address
bc1q70a5xdjlttg2efg5j5uyaepgnc4ayvzke6fk8k
transaction
8d3fccefa10d6ce03667c948bf381908c13aaf511b7409018bb0089ddbaaf046
confirmations
46801
spent
false